  • Narration

    Koby walks dejectedly along the shore of the island, sighing. He spots a large wooden barrel washed up on the beach. Three of Alvida's crewmen—a tall slender pirate with parted hair, a muscular pirate with a goatee, and a stocky bearded pirate—approach him. The goateed pirate asks, "WHAT'S THAT, KOBY? DID A BARREL OF RUM WASH UP ON THE BEACH?" Koby replies, "Y-YEAH. AND IT'S NOT EMPTY! I WASN'T SURE WHAT TO DO WITH IT..." The slender pirate suggests, "WELL I KNOW WHAT TO DO WITH IT! LET'S DRINK IT ALL UP!" The bearded pirate worries, "BUT IF THE CAPTAIN FINDS OUT, SHE'LL HAVE OUR HEADS!" The slender pirate dismisses this, saying, "SHE'LL NEVER FIND OUT! WE'RE THE ONLY ONES HERE. JUST KOBY AND THE THREE OF US KNOW ABOUT THIS. I GUESS YOU'RE RIGHT." The bearded pirate growls at Koby, "AND YOU AIN'T SEEN NOTHIN', RIGHT, KOBY?" Koby nervously waves his hands, pleading, "RIGHT! I-I AIN'T SEEN NOTHIN'! HEH HEH HEH. PLEASE DON'T HIT ME..."
